Transaction f78959067147d8b283b70eeaf63f63516f8f4003ab58a7276982c9685a0764de

67 Input
2 Outputs
  • f78959067147d8b283b70eeaf63f63516f8f4003ab58a7276982c9685a0764de:0
  • value  403801745
    address  3JUgzpdZdxzsfouk4QqLy6j9aRLn1B4HUj
  • f78959067147d8b283b70eeaf63f63516f8f4003ab58a7276982c9685a0764de:1
  • value  935994
    address  17sdNbXkKhsinQceRBoSLi4Cd9Gn8mXLGz